What We’re Learning About A Spider-Punk Movie
According to Deadline, a movie based on Spider-Punk is now in early development. The film will be co-written by Kaluuya and Ajon Singh, but plot details are being kept under wraps at this time. No other deals are in place, meaning it’s unclear if any other characters from the previous Spider-Verse movies will also show up.
The Amazing Spider-Man #10, created by Dan Slott and Olivier Coipel, marked the debut of the Spider-Punk/Hobie Brown character in 2015. This version of Spider-Man resides on Earth-138, where he fights against corrupt systems, corporations, and governments.
While we don’t have a release date for the Spider-Punk spin-off, it’s likely that it won’t arrive until after Spider-Man: Beyond the Spider-Verse. Beyond the Spider-Verse will build off the cliffhanger featured in Across the Spider-Verse, where Miles Morales/Spider-Man is now on Earth-42 and facing a seemingly evil version of himself.
